United Airlines B777 Diverts to Anchorage Due to Fuel Leak

United Airlines flight UA130, a B777-200 bound for Newark from Tokyo, diverted to Anchorage after reporting a fuel leak inflight on 18 April.

Alaska Airlines B737 Ends in Ditch While Being Moved by Mechanics at Anchorage Airport

An Alaska Airlines B737-900 being repositioned by two mechanics suffered a taxiway excursion before sliding into a ditch at Anchorage Ted Stevens Airport on 8 January.

Alaska Airlines to Launch New Flights from Anchorage to Detroit and Sacramento

Alaska Airlines will further enhance its summer 2025 route network with the introduction of nonstop flights connecting Anchorage to Detroit and Sacramento.

Cathay Pacific Inaugurates New Hong Kong-Dallas Route

Cathay Pacific has expanded its North American network; inaugurating a new non-stop service between Hong Kong and Dallas Fort Worth International Airport on April 24, 2025.

Hawaiian Airlines to Commence New Nonstop Seattle-Seoul Flights

Hawaiian Airlines is set to commence nonstop flight between Seattle and Seoul, with flights from 12 September to be initially served by its A330-200 aircraft.

FedEx Expands Fleet with New Order of 10 ATR 72-600F Freighters

FedEx has announced the purchase of 10 additional ATR 72-600F freighters, building upon a previous order of 30 aircraft.

Bering Air Flight Vanishes Near Nome Alaska, Search Underway

A Bering Air flight with 10 people on board disappeared from radar near Nome, Alaska on 6 February sparking a large-scale search and rescue operation.
